Pool fence painting services involve applying protective and decorative coatings to existing pool fences, typically made of wood, metal, or vinyl. This process helps refresh the appearance of the fence, making it look newer and well-maintained. The work often includes surface pre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, to ensure the paint adheres properly and lasts longer. Skilled contractors use quality paints designed specifically for outdoor use, providing a durable finish that can withstand weather conditions and prevent rust, rot, or peeling over time.
This service addresses common problems like faded, chipped, or peeling paint that can make a pool area look neglected. It also helps improve the overall aesthetic, giving the property a cleaner, more inviting feel. Additionally, repainting a pool fence can serve as a protective measure, helping to prevent damage caused by moisture, sun exposure, and temperature fluctuations. The overview below groups typical Pool Fence Painting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most routine pool fence painting projects typically fall within the $250-$600 range. These jobs often involve touch-ups or repainting smaller sections of fencing. Many local contractors handle projects in this price band regularly.
Mid-Size Projects - Medium-sized pool fence painting jobs generally cost between $600 and $1,200. This range covers standard fencing repainting for average-sized pools with some prep work involved. Fewer projects extend into higher price tiers within this band.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ger projects, such as extensive repainting of multiple fence sections or fences with special surface requirements, can range from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ects may involve additional prep or surface treatment, which can increase costs.
Full Replacement or Custom Work - Complete fence repainting or custom finishes can exceed $3,000, with some larger or highly detailed projects reaching $5,000 or more. Such projects are less common and typically involve significant surface preparation or specialty coatings.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is pool fence painting? Pool fence painting involves applying a protective and decorative coating to the surface of a pool fence, typically made of materials like metal or wood, to enhance appearance and durability.
Why should I consider painting my pool fence? Painting a pool fence can improve its aesthetic appeal, provide protection against weathering and corrosion, and help maintain the fence's structural integrity over time.
What types of paint are suitable for pool fences? Service providers typically recommend weather-resistant, outdoor-grade paints such as rust-inhibiting metal paints or durable wood stains, depending on the fence material.
How do local contractors prepare a pool fence for painting? Preparation usually includes cleaning the fence thoroughly, removing loose paint or rust, sanding rough areas, and applying a primer to ensure proper adhesion of the new coat.
Can pool fence painting be combined with other fence repairs? Yes, many local professionals offer combined services such as minor repairs, sanding, and painting to ensure the fence looks and functions well after the work is completed.
